Why a Clutter-Free Office Matters
A tidy workspace helps clear your mind and improve concentration. When everything has a place, it’s easier to find what you need, saving time and reducing frustration. Plus, an organized office can be more comfortable and inspiring, making it easier to settle in and focus on your tasks.
Step 1: Choose the Right Space
Start by selecting a dedicated area for your home office. Even a small corner can work if organized thoughtfully. Ideally, choose a quiet spot with good natural light to help boost energy and reduce eye strain.
Step 2: Declutter and Simplify
Before adding any storage solutions, clear out your current workspace.
– Sort through items: Decide what is necessary and what can be discarded or stored elsewhere.
– Remove duplicates: Keep only the essentials to avoid overcrowding.
– Clear surfaces: A clean desk surface helps maintain focus.
Regularly repeating this decluttering step keeps your office tidy over time.
Step 3: Organize with Purposeful Storage
Proper storage solutions are the backbone of an organized office.
– Use vertical space: Shelves or wall organizers keep items off your desk but within reach.
– Drawer organizers: Separate pens, paperclips, and other small items to avoid clutter.
– Storage boxes or bins: Label them clearly for files, supplies, or miscellaneous items.
– Cable management: Use clips or sleeves to keep cords neat and prevent tangling.
Choose storage that fits your style and the size of your workspace to maintain a clean look.
Step 4: Arrange Your Desk for Efficiency
Your desk setup impacts how smoothly your work flows.
– Keep essentials close: Place frequently used tools like your computer, notebook, and pens within easy reach.
– Limit decorations: A few personal touches are fine but avoid overloading your desk.
– Maintain good ergonomics: Position your chair, monitor, and keyboard to avoid strain.
Remember, a clear desk promotes a clear mind.
Step 5: Implement Daily and Weekly Maintenance
Maintaining a clutter-free office requires regular habits.
– End-of-day tidy-up: Spend 5 minutes putting things away before finishing work.
– Weekly review: Reassess your space weekly to remove unnecessary items.
– Paper management: Digitize documents when possible to reduce paper clutter.
Small daily actions prevent mess from piling up and reduce the need for big cleanups.
